Remedy Action and Second Prescription

 
Jonathan Shore (Author)
Synopsis Prescribing is the first step towards curing the sick to health. Its importance is authentic and evident. Remedy action is well studied under a fruitful practice of classical homeopathy, in this series of lectures various remedy actions have been elaborated with associated cases. This collection of lectures comprises various cases discussed in seminars highlighting the utility of first and second prescription in homeopathy. It is a textual translation of all the visual cases discussed by the stalwarts which are extremely informative and directional for any homeopathic practitioner. This transcription includes Alize Timmermans presentation of a very interesting video case.

About the author

Jonathan Shore

Jonathan Shore M.D., DHt, MF Hom was born on August 6, 1943, in Cape Town, South Africa. He graduated from the University of Cape Town Medical School in 1968. He has intensive knowledge of Acupuncture, Tai-Chi Chuan, Massage, Jungian psychology Gestalt therapy, Bioenergetics, Rolfing, Radiesthesia, Iridology, Herbal Medicine, Bach Flower remedies, and Colour therapy. Since 1982, he has been a full time homeopathic practitioner in the San Francisco area. Dr Shore has a private practice and works at the Hahnemann Clinic, of which he was one of the initiating founders. Dr. Shore has taught worldwide since 1983. In 1992, he was awarded membership of The Faculty of Homeopathy, England. He is on the editorial board and is a past editor of the Journal of the American Institute of Homeopathy.
